admin 管理员组

文章数量: 1087709


2024年3月20日发(作者:delay效果器)

APK签名命令常见问题解析及应对方法

APK签名命令是Android开发中不可或缺的一环,它能够保证应

用程序完整性和安全性,防止应用程序被篡改和恶意攻击。然而,APK

签名命令也可能会出现一些问题,给开发者带来不便。本文将为读者

详细解析APK签名命令常见问题及应对方法。

1. 问题一:无法签名APK文件

签名APK文件时,可能会出现无法签名的情况。这可能是由于权

限问题导致的。在签名APK文件之前,需要确保操作系统中的Java环

境已经正确配置,确保具有足够的权限。

解决方法:检查Java环境是否配置正确,确保具有足够的权限,

并使用正确的命令进行签名操作。

2. 问题二:签名后应用程序无法安装

在签名完成后,应用程序可能会无法安装。这可能是由于签名证

书过期或者应用程序包名与签名证书不匹配所致。

解决方法:检查签名证书是否已过期,并确保应用程序包名与签

名证书一致。如果证书已过期,需要重新生成签名证书;如果包名与

证书不一致,需要重新签名。

3. 问题三:签名后应用程序无法运行

在签名完成后,应用程序可能会无法运行。这可能是由于签名证

书被撤销或者应用程序包名被恶意篡改所致。

解决方法:检查签名证书的状态,并确保应用程序包名未被篡

改。如果证书被撤销,需要重新生成签名证书;如果包名被篡改,可

以使用反编译工具查看签名信息来确定问题所在。

第 1 页 共 2 页

4. 问题四:签名后应用程序出现安全漏洞

在签名完成后,应用程序可能会出现安全漏洞,这可能是由于签

名证书被窃取或者签名算法被攻击所致。

解决方法:检查签名证书是否存在安全问题,并确保签名算法足

够安全。如果证书被窃取,需要立即吊销证书并重新生成;如果签名

算法被攻击,需要采用更加安全的签名算法进行签名。

5. 问题五:APK签名命令无法操作

在使用APK签名命令时,可能会遇到无法操作的情况,这可能是

由于命令格式错误或者命令所在目录不正确所致。

解决方法:检查命令格式是否正确,并确保命令所在目录正确。

如果命令格式错误,可以查阅相关文档或使用工具进行命令生成;如

果命令所在目录不正确,需要使用正确的目录进行操作。

6. 问题六:签名后应用程序无法发布

在签名完成后,应用程序可能会无法发布,这可能是由于签名证

书不合法所致。

解决方法:检查签名证书是否符合相关标准,如果不符合,需要

重新生成符合标准的签名证书。

以上就是APK签名命令常见问题及应对方法的介绍。在使用APK

签名命令时,需要仔细操作,确保签名证书的合法性以及命令的正确

性,避免出现问题。同时,可以使用相关工具或咨询专业人士来解决

问题。只有保障应用程序的安全性和完整性,才能更好地保护用户隐

私和数据安全。

第 2 页 共 2 页


本文标签: 签名 证书 命令